ABP
Volosoft
Empower your development with seamless, modular application solutions.
ABP serves as a robust platform built on the open-source ABP framework. It features an array of pre-constructed modules, tools for rapid application development, professional user interface themes, and high-quality support services. The ABP framework is designed to be modular and compatible with microservices, making it ideal for ASP.NET Core application development. Its architecture provides a strong foundation that enables developers to prioritize their business logic without the need for repetitive coding across different projects. Grounded in established software development best practices and familiar tools, it streamlines the development process. Once an ABP License is acquired, you can generate an unlimited number of solutions effortlessly. The provided solution package comes equipped with commercial themes and modules that are pre-installed and configured for immediate use. Furthermore, you have the flexibility to either uninstall existing modules or remove them entirely if they are no longer needed. All themes and modules are efficiently managed through NuGet/NPM packages, ensuring seamless integration into your projects. BoxyHQ
BoxyHQ
Empower your security with seamless integration and compliance tools.
Developers can enhance their security infrastructure with essential building blocks provided by BoxyHQ. This platform features a comprehensive set of APIs designed for enterprise compliance, security, and privacy, enabling engineering teams to accelerate their Time to Market while maintaining robust security measures. With minimal coding effort, teams can integrate a variety of critical functionalities, whether they choose a SaaS model or a self-hosted solution. The available features include Enterprise Single Sign-On (SAML/OIDC SSO), Directory Synchronization, detailed Audit Logs, and a Data Privacy Vault that adheres to PII, PCI, and PHI compliance standards. By leveraging these tools, organizations can effectively safeguard their data and streamline user authentication processes.

Bullet Train
Bullet Train
Accelerate development, innovate freely with powerful scaffolding solutions.
Bullet Train is a robust framework constructed on Rails and licensed under MIT, designed to expedite development by offering a strong foundation with essential features, enabling developers to focus on the distinctive elements of their applications. Its Super Scaffolding capability allows users to easily create production-ready views and resource controllers, while also permitting the addition of new fields to existing scaffolds. Incorporating team functionalities from the beginning is vital to avoid significant hurdles in the future, and Bullet Train excels in addressing this need. The framework features seamless integration with CanCanCan, which ensures that users have access only to the relevant resources and features via both the web interface and REST API. Bullet Train enhances the user experience with a professionally designed UI theme using Tailwind CSS, significantly improving the aesthetic quality of applications. Additionally, its MIT licensing empowers developers with the freedom to create, share, or monetize their custom themes, contributing to a dynamic ecosystem of design options. Basejump
Basejump
Amplify your Supabase applications with seamless, customizable solutions.
Basejump acts as an open-source SaaS starter kit that significantly amplifies the functionality of Supabase applications by integrating essential features such as authentication, individual and team accounts, member permissions, and subscription billing management powered by Stripe. Developers can seamlessly incorporate Basejump into their current projects with just a single migration file, utilizing Supabase libraries that cater to various programming languages, including JavaScript, Python, Go, and Swift. Moreover, the platform offers customizable React components created with shadcn and Tailwind CSS, enabling rapid deployment while allowing full control over the user interface. By leveraging Supabase's Row Level Security (RLS) policies, Basejump effectively implements data access restrictions that align with user roles, enhancing security and streamlining permission management processes. With all data securely stored in the user's Supabase database, developers enjoy extensive customization options and the flexibility to add more tables as needed. This adaptability not only positions Basejump as a powerful authentication mechanism but also as a versatile billing solution. Cascade
Cascade
Streamline SaaS development with integrated tools and features.
Cascade is a free, open-source boilerplate designed specifically for software-as-a-service (SaaS) applications, aimed at streamlining the development process through a comprehensive suite of integrated tools and features. It includes essential functionalities such as payment processing, error monitoring, analytics, job management, and email marketing, all within a single platform. This level of integration allows developers to focus on building the core business logic right from the start, which simplifies the overall development workflow and reduces the time needed to bring products to market. With its modular architecture, Cascade offers both scalability and adaptability, making it suitable for a wide range of projects. By providing a unified platform that incorporates critical features, Cascade enables developers to efficiently create robust SaaS applications without the hassle of managing multiple disparate systems. CorsegoSaaS
CorsegoSaaS
Accelerate your SaaS development with powerful multitenancy solutions.
CorsegoSaaS is a Ruby on Rails 6 framework designed specifically for multitenancy, which accelerates the development of scalable multi-tenant SaaS applications. It features a diverse range of capabilities, including user authentication methods such as email, Google, and GitHub logins, along with the ability to associate multiple social media accounts with a single user profile for added convenience. The framework supports complete row-based multitenancy, allowing developers to create different tenants like organizations or teams, seamlessly switch between them, invite members, and manage access permissions effectively. User authorization is made simple through customizable roles (admin, editor, viewer), aided by plan-based restrictions that enable the creation of tailored pricing tiers and limits, such as capping the number of members allowed per tenant. The integrated billing and subscription features are powered by a custom engine with Stripe integration, which handles both recurring payments and one-off transactions effortlessly. Furthermore, an easy-to-use super admin panel enhances the management of users, tenants, pricing plans, subscriptions, and financial transactions. With this extensive array of tools, developers are well-equipped to create powerful and adaptable SaaS applications with greater speed and efficiency.
